Abstract

PROBLEM TO BE SOLVED: To provide a liftable chair which is simply configured, is thinly foldable and storable without taking a large space.SOLUTION: Guide grooves 4 are formed on side faces of columns 1 provided in an opposing state. A back frame 2 is vertically movably provided between the columns 1, and has a lower guide shaft 15 and an upper guide shaft 16 to be inserted to the guide grooves 4. The back frame 2 is provided with a seat stay 14, and a seat 3 is attached to the seat stay 14 so as to be turned to a sprung-up position and a horizontal position. When the back frame 2 is elevated, the upper guide shaft 16 enters a stopper groove 7 and the back frame 2 is held in an inclined state so as not to be lowered.

該支柱1の内側面には、上下方向に延びるガイド溝4が形成され、角筒状の支柱1の内面の後方側に内接するよう内方角パイプ5を挿入固定し、該内方角パイプ5の前方側に上記ガイド溝4に開口する案内空間6を形成してある。該ガイド溝4の上端には、後方に延びるストッパー溝7が形成され、該ストッパー溝7は、図4に示すように略倒L字状に屈曲しており、これに対応して上記内方角パイプ5の上端には弧状の受け片を設けて受部8が形成されている。支柱1の上端は、蓋片9で閉塞されている。   A guide groove 4 extending in the vertical direction is formed on the inner side surface of the column 1, and an inner square pipe 5 is inserted and fixed so as to be inscribed on the rear side of the inner surface of the square columnar column 1. A guide space 6 opening in the guide groove 4 is formed on the front side. A stopper groove 7 extending rearward is formed at the upper end of the guide groove 4, and the stopper groove 7 is bent in a substantially inverted L shape as shown in FIG. A receiving portion 8 is formed by providing an arc-shaped receiving piece at the upper end of the pipe 5. The upper end of the column 1 is closed with a lid piece 9.

上記支柱1は倒伏、起立可能に構成したり、上下に上昇、降下できるように構成することができる。図に示す実施例では、各支柱の下端を角筒状の駆動軸10に連結し、該駆動軸10を手動操作やモーター等の電動操作により回転させて、支柱1を起立させたり、倒伏させたりすることができるようにしてある。上下動可能に構成するには、手動操作で上下動させたり、適宜のシリンダー機構で上下動させればよい。なお、いずれの場合も、支柱1を起立状態に保持できるよう適宜の保持機構(図示略)を設けることが好ましい。   The support column 1 can be configured to be able to fall down and stand up, or can be configured to rise and fall vertically. In the embodiment shown in the figure, the lower end of each column is connected to a rectangular tube-shaped drive shaft 10, and the drive shaft 10 is rotated by a manual operation or an electric operation such as a motor to raise or lower the column 1. It can be done. In order to be able to move up and down, it may be moved up and down by manual operation or moved up and down by an appropriate cylinder mechanism. In any case, it is preferable to provide an appropriate holding mechanism (not shown) so that the column 1 can be held upright.

上記背フレーム2は、上記支柱1の内側面に沿う側枠部11と、該側枠部11の上端を連結する背枠部12を有し、該背枠部12は身体の背部に沿うよう湾曲している。該側枠部11の下方は下部ステー13で連結されており、中間部には座ステー14が固定されている。該側枠部11には、上記支柱1のガイド溝4に上下方向に移動可能に挿入される下部ガイド軸15と、その上方に位置する上部ガイド軸16が設けられている。各ガイド軸15、16の先端にはそれぞれ上記支柱の案内空間6内に内接して転動するようローラー17が設けられている。上記下部ガイド軸15は、上記ガイド溝4及び案内空間6内のみを移動するが、上記上部ガイド軸16は、背フレーム2を上昇させた際、上記ストッパー溝7に入り込むことが可能であり、該ストッパー溝7に入り込んだ上部ガイド軸16のローラー17は上記受部8で支承される。これにより、背フレーム2は、降下するおそれはなく、上昇位置で確実に保持され、荷重を支えることができる。   The back frame 2 has a side frame portion 11 along the inner surface of the support column 1 and a back frame portion 12 that connects the upper ends of the side frame portions 11 so that the back frame portion 12 follows the back portion of the body. It is curved. The lower side of the side frame portion 11 is connected by a lower stay 13, and a seat stay 14 is fixed to an intermediate portion. The side frame portion 11 is provided with a lower guide shaft 15 that is inserted in the guide groove 4 of the support column 1 so as to be movable in the vertical direction, and an upper guide shaft 16 positioned above the lower guide shaft 15. A roller 17 is provided at the tip of each guide shaft 15, 16 so as to roll in contact with the guide space 6 of the column. The lower guide shaft 15 moves only in the guide groove 4 and the guide space 6, but the upper guide shaft 16 can enter the stopper groove 7 when the back frame 2 is raised, The roller 17 of the upper guide shaft 16 that has entered the stopper groove 7 is supported by the receiving portion 8. Thereby, there is no possibility that the back frame 2 descends, and the back frame 2 can be reliably held at the raised position and can support the load.

上記座3は座ステー14に取り付けられ、跳ね上げ位置とほぼ水平の着座位置に移動できるよう適宜の取付構造により回動可能に保持されている。図に示す実施例では、座ステー14に座受部18及び側面部19を有する断面略コ字状の座受ブラケット20を回動可能に取り付け、該座受ブラケット20の座受部18に座3を固定してある。座3の裏面側には裏面を覆うカバー21が取り付けられ、該カバー21には手掛け凹部22が設けられている。   The seat 3 is attached to a seat stay 14, and is rotatably held by an appropriate attachment structure so that the seat 3 can be moved to a seating position substantially horizontal to the flip-up position. In the illustrated embodiment, a seat bracket 20 having a substantially U-shaped cross section having a seat receiving portion 18 and a side surface portion 19 is rotatably attached to the seat stay 14, and the seat receiving portion 18 of the seat receiving bracket 20 is seated on the seat receiving portion 18. 3 is fixed. A cover 21 covering the back surface is attached to the back surface side of the seat 3, and a handle recess 22 is provided in the cover 21.

上記座受ブラケット20の側面部19には、上記座ステー14に嵌合する受溝23が形成され、該座ステー14の裏面側から座受ブラケット20の側面部19間に入り込むよう受溝24を有する回転受ブラケット25を座3に取り付けてある。座ステー14には、座3がほぼ水平位置に回動したとき、上記座受ブラケット20の座受部18の裏面に当接して、座3の回動を停止させてその位置に保持できるようストッパー26を固定してある。この構成により、座3はほぼ水平位置で停止し、着座することができる。また、座3の先部を跳ね上げれば、座3は回動して上端が背フレーム2の背枠部12方向に移動し、ほぼ側枠部11に沿って並列する。この際、上記カバー21の後端等に上記下部ステー13に嵌着する適宜の留め具(図示略)を設けておけば、座3を跳ね上げた状態で保持することができる。   A receiving groove 23 that fits into the seat stay 14 is formed in the side surface portion 19 of the seat bracket 20, and the receiving groove 24 enters the space between the side surface portions 19 of the seat bracket 20 from the back surface side of the seat stay 14. A rotation receiving bracket 25 having the structure is attached to the seat 3. When the seat 3 rotates to a substantially horizontal position, the seat stay 14 contacts the back surface of the seat receiving portion 18 of the seat bracket 20 so that the rotation of the seat 3 can be stopped and held at that position. The stopper 26 is fixed. With this configuration, the seat 3 can be stopped and seated at a substantially horizontal position. Further, if the front portion of the seat 3 is flipped up, the seat 3 rotates and the upper end moves in the direction of the back frame portion 12 of the back frame 2, and is aligned substantially along the side frame portion 11. At this time, if an appropriate fastener (not shown) fitted to the lower stay 13 is provided at the rear end or the like of the cover 21, the seat 3 can be held in a raised state.

上記支柱、背フレーム、座等で構成される椅子ユニット27は、並列して設けることができる。図に示す実施例では、上記椅子ユニット27を3脚横方向に並べ、かつ前後に同様に配列して、該椅子ユニット27を前方列、後方列ごとに駆動軸10に固定し、6脚の椅子ユニットを倒伏状態でほぼ畳一畳分内に格納できるようにしてある。そして、一方側の椅子ユニットの支柱1は倒伏状態から反時計方向に回転して起立し、他方の支柱1は時計方向に回転して起立するように各駆動軸の回転方向を制御し、この駆動軸を畳の下等の床下に設けてある。上記椅子ユニット27を収納した格納部28の上面を覆うよう床面や畳面には、折りたたみ可能に上面板29を設けてある。この上面板29はヒンジ30を介して二つ折りできるよう連結された2つの部材で構成され、基端がヒンジ31を介して格納部28の側方に設けたバラケット32に連結されている。上面板29の裏面や支柱1の側面には適宜のスペーサー33を設けてあり、上面板29を展開したとき、上面板29が撓まないようにしてある。   The chair unit 27 composed of the support column, the back frame, the seat and the like can be provided in parallel. In the embodiment shown in the figure, the above-mentioned chair units 27 are arranged side by side in the horizontal direction and arranged in the same manner in the front and rear, and the chair units 27 are fixed to the drive shaft 10 for each of the front row and the rear row. The chair unit can be stored almost in a tatami mat in a lying state. Then, the support column 1 of the chair unit on one side is rotated counterclockwise from the lying state to stand upright, and the other support column 1 is rotated clockwise to control the rotation direction of each drive shaft. The drive shaft is provided under the floor such as under the tatami mat. An upper surface plate 29 is provided on the floor surface and the tatami surface so as to cover the upper surface of the storage unit 28 in which the chair unit 27 is accommodated. The top plate 29 is composed of two members connected so as to be able to be folded in two via a hinge 30, and the base end is connected to a ballet 32 provided on the side of the storage portion 28 via a hinge 31. Appropriate spacers 33 are provided on the back surface of the upper surface plate 29 and the side surfaces of the support column 1 so that the upper surface plate 29 does not bend when the upper surface plate 29 is unfolded.

上記ように構成された椅子ユニット27は、不使用時、図7に示すように床下に格納され、格納部28の上面には畳等を表面に形成した上面板29で塞がれている。そして、使用に際しては、上記上面板29を手で持ち上げ、手動操作若しくは電動操作で上記駆動軸10を回転させると、支柱1は回動して図8に示すように次第に起立する。   When not in use, the chair unit 27 configured as described above is stored under the floor as shown in FIG. 7, and the upper surface of the storage unit 28 is closed by an upper surface plate 29 having a tatami mat or the like formed on the surface. In use, when the upper plate 29 is lifted by hand and the drive shaft 10 is rotated by manual operation or electric operation, the column 1 rotates and gradually rises as shown in FIG.

上記支柱1が完全に起立すると、図9に示すように、上面板29は折りたたまれ、支柱1の前面若しくは後面に沿って位置する。そして、図10に示すように、上記背フレーム2を引き上げ、上部ガイド軸16をストッパー溝7に係合させれば、背フレーム2はその上端が後方に傾斜し、上昇位置に保持される(図11)。最後に座3をほぼ水平の着座状態に展開させると、図12に示すように椅子が完成するから、着座することができる。収納するには、上記と逆の手順で、座3を跳ね上げ、背フレーム2を支柱1に沿って降下させ、支柱1を倒伏して格納部28内に収納し、その上面を上面板で覆えばよい。   When the support column 1 stands up completely, as shown in FIG. 9, the upper surface plate 29 is folded and positioned along the front surface or the rear surface of the support column 1. Then, as shown in FIG. 10, when the back frame 2 is pulled up and the upper guide shaft 16 is engaged with the stopper groove 7, the upper end of the back frame 2 is inclined rearward and held in the raised position ( FIG. 11). Finally, when the seat 3 is expanded to a substantially horizontal seating state, the chair is completed as shown in FIG. To store, the seat 3 is flipped up in the reverse procedure, the back frame 2 is lowered along the support column 1, the support column 1 is laid down and stored in the storage unit 28, and the upper surface is covered with the upper surface plate.
